Transaction f0591c21d4cb95205b33cd62e747e5cf21fee3dea0abd3299e54a0ea5f6ff723

1 Input
2 Outputs
  • f0591c21d4cb95205b33cd62e747e5cf21fee3dea0abd3299e54a0ea5f6ff723:0
  • value  1634000
    address  1H9W6LW2w3zAWiAsE1ihRYU39JuYKUc4Lo
  • f0591c21d4cb95205b33cd62e747e5cf21fee3dea0abd3299e54a0ea5f6ff723:1
  • value  80718765
    address  3PkCsgPHafdwRdoPMSN76gvm1Pmzr5JqFc